Enpatoran for Lupus

This trial is testing M5049 to see if it is an effective and safe treatment for lupus over 24 weeks. It is a rand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led, adaptive and dose-ranging study, which means that participants are randomly assigned to either receive the drug or a placebo, and neither they nor the researchers know who is receiving which. The study will last 33 weeks and participants will visit the clinic every 2 or 4 weeks.
